For those of us who don’t know the first thing about wiring up such a creation, other Redditors have even chipped in to help with instructions on how to build your own:
If using a 9V battery, you’ll need to connect 6 LEDs (in this example: forward V = 1.5V) in series such that 1.5V*6=9V. This will change depending on the forward voltage of your LED. Next, you choose a resistor that will cause the forward current of your diodes to equal the current flow of the circuit.
